3. Cook Low & Slow
- Cover tightly; reduce heat to low.
- Simmer 2–2.5 hours, until beef is fork-tender and falling apart.
- Do not boil—gentle simmer = tender meat.
4. Finish with Vinegar
- Stir in apple cider vinegar—this brightens the rich flavors and balances the dish.
- Taste; adjust salt if needed.

Make-Ahead & Storage Tips
- Fridge: Keeps up to 4 days—flavor deepens overnight!
- Freeze: Freeze up to 3 months; thaw and reheat gently.
- Slow cooker option: Brown beef, then cook on LOW 7–8 hours.
